FlorianSW/server-donation-tool

One package for multiple servers

FlorianSW opened this issue · 1 comments

One use case is, that there are different packages, which are basically the same for multiple servers. Right now, one needs to create multiple packages, even though the only thing that changes is the priority perk (for what server it will be added for).

For such use case, it would be good to have the possibility to configure a package, which contains a priority queue perk. This perk then has a configuration of the cftools server IDs. The user will be presented with a dropdown, where they need to choose for what server they would like to have the priority queue.

  • Configure multiple servers in the priority queue perk
  • Render a selection menu when a donator wants to donate for a multi-options priority queue perk
  • Redeem the priority queue for the selected server on multi-options priority queue perk
  • Consider how multi-options priority queue perks work with Subscriptions
  • Render the selected server in the redeem now page (instead of the "one of servers" message)

Will be released with the next release :)